Plaintiff: William Robinson and Sam: Purluvent, [gentlemen]. Defendant: Henry Harington...Nicholls, Carew, Heathcote... Foliated 1-9 (10 pages plus two scraps of later notes in red). Docketed "...Fair Copy Decree. Birch Chan...Office." Concerning debts, bonds, and mortgages. Righthand edge and gutter fragile, measures 41.5 x 33.9 cm.

Processing Information

Formerly pinned in top left corner, folded once and sewn along the gutter, thus produced in order to be bound with the other decrees. This sewing was removed by Spencer Research Library staff in 1975 and the leaves left unfastened.
